Marathon did it again. Again he stayed on the path to the CONCACAF Champions and did so in an ugly way: thrashed and crushed, now by the Portland Timbers of the MLS that gave him a painful 5-0 at home by a global beating of 7-2.
The first minutes looked like they were going to give the fight, they had some clear, but these teams on their court, with their speed, touch and good technique, can not compete. Two clear arrivals on the left side of Luis Vega with races from the Colombian Asprilla, opened the tap for the lumberjacks.

Colombian Yimmi Chara turned into a nightmare, made a treble that got on his knees and stripped away the shortcomings of the green that what he presented at the Olympics last Tuesday was fortune. The marked differences were evidenced in Portland and now that the failure is consummated only these statistics remain with numbers that weigh.
In the second half the Portland team came out determined to show their fangs. The woodcutter had his chainsaw on and early in the 66th minute Diego Valeri’s third goal came. A combination with Van Rankin ended in Denovan’s bow.

Later the goalkeeper of the greens continued to give spaces and at 79, chara scored the third after a rebound from the guard and here everything deflated. The beating was about to fall, but a fifth is missing. The tic Marvin Loría made a run in the 89th minute and before the goalkeeper’s departure, he beat him with a falling shot.
Héctor Vargas in the second half took out the players who were in danger such as Bryan Castell who ended up injured and Marlon “Machuca” Ramírez and brought in Kevin Hoyos and Ryduan Palermos who were nothing more than tourism in the game, as they did not lead a single play of danger to 45 minutes of game.
For Marató, these presentations in CONCACAF should serve as a reflection because their name has been degraded; in the 2018-2019 edition they were eliminated 11-2 by Santos Laguna and now be a 7-2 by Portland. Now they have to come to focus on qualifying in the local tournament where they are last in Group A.
